HookC Wins Third-Straight, Clinches Series in Greensboro
GREENSBORO, N.C. - The UConn baseball team (9-11) won its third-straight game to capture a series win at UNC Greensboro (10-12), 5-2, on Saturday afternoon at the UNCG Baseball Stadium.
LHP Cayden Suchy posted a career-high 7.0 innings, allowed one unearned run and struck out a career-best nine batters en route to his second win of the season.
The UConn offense gave him plenty of support with a four-run fourth inning. Sophoore Tyler Minick launched his seventh home run of the year to make it 1-0 Huskies.
After a Grant MacArthur double, freshman Anthony Belisario plated the UConn first baseman with an RBI single to center. Belisario finished the day with his second-straight multi-hit game of the weekend.
Caleb Shpur capped the frame with a two-out, two-run triple just past the dive of the right fielder in the right field corner.
After the Spartans made it a 4-2 game in the eight, redshirt freshman Rob Rispoli hit an opposite field home run to push the UConn lead back to three, 5-2. It is the second home run of the year for the UConn shortstop.
UConn closer Brady Afthim registered the final five outs of the ballgame to lock down a third-straight save for the Huskies.

Game Notes
- Rob Rispoli has reached base in a team-high 18-straight games.
- The Huskies hit a pair of home runs on Saturday, snapping a six game stretch without a long ball.
- Five Huskies finished the game with a mutli-hit effort (Minick, MacArthur, Shpur, Aidan Dougherty and Belisario).
- UConn is 8-1 this season when the pitching staff allows five runs or fewer.
- After not having a starter work past the sixth in its first 18 games, the Huskies have had back-to-back 7.0 inning outings out of their starters this weekend.
- UConn pitching has struck out 28 batters in the first two games of the series.
